News & Updates

Run APK in Browser: Instant Android Apps No Download

By Ava Sinclair 142 Views
run apk in browser
Run APK in Browser: Instant Android Apps No Download

Running an APK directly inside a web browser removes the friction of installing Android software on a desktop or iOS machine. This process creates a seamless bridge between mobile applications and the web, allowing users to test, demo, or utilize Android APKs without leaving their current environment.

Understanding the Technology Behind Browser Execution

The core technology enabling this capability relies on WebAssembly and advanced emulation techniques. Rather than converting the APK file into a native binary, platforms utilize a translation layer that interprets the Android runtime within the JavaScript engine of the browser. This allows the code to execute instructions at near-native speeds while maintaining security through sandboxing.

Step-by-Step Guide to Launching APK Files

The process is straightforward and requires only a modern web interface. Users upload the file or specify a URL, and the platform handles the rest. Below is a breakdown of the typical workflow:

Access a trusted web-based APK runner service.

Upload the APK file from your local device or input a direct link.

Initialize the virtual environment with a single click.

Interact with the application using mouse and keyboard inputs.

Key Advantages of Browser-Based Execution

Accessibility is the primary benefit of this method. Users can access their favorite Android apps on Chromebooks, Macs, or Windows PCs without installing additional virtualization software. This approach also eliminates the risk of contaminating the host operating system with potentially unstable software.

Performance Considerations and Limitations

While the technology is impressive, it is important to understand the boundaries of execution. Graphics-intensive games or applications requiring heavy sensor integration may experience latency or reduced functionality. The virtualized environment relies on the host machine’s CPU and RAM, meaning hardware specifications directly impact the experience.

When using third-party services, the APK file is processed on remote servers. This requires trust in the platform’s security protocols to ensure data isolation and privacy. For sensitive tasks, local solutions that run entirely offline are recommended to mitigate data exposure risks.

Developers benefit from this workflow by testing responsive layouts and user interactions across various screen sizes without needing a physical device. Casual users might want to try a mobile game on a large monitor or use a messaging app on a desktop interface, all without switching devices or operating systems.

User Type
Primary Use Case
Benefit
Developer
UI Testing
Quick iteration without device setup
Casual User
Media Consumption
Larger screen experience on mobile apps
Enterprise
Legacy App Access
Run old Android apps on new hardware
A

Written by Ava Sinclair

Ava Sinclair is a Senior Editor covering culture, travel, and premium experiences. She focuses on clear reporting and practical takeaways.